  • Page 2 AC-DA12-AUHD Introduction The AC-DA12-AUHD is an 18GBPS, full bandwidth HDMI2.0a (HDR) with HDCP2.2 two-way HDMI splitter. Functionally, distributes the input HDMI signal to four identical HDMI outputs. These four outputs are synchronized. AC-DA12-AUHD has the ability of pre-emphasis and equalization. Multiple cascaded AC- DA12-AUHD achieves long distance transmission of HDMI signal of more than 15 meters even in 4K (HDR) resolution.

  • Page 10 AC-DA12-AUHD EDID Settings: The 5 DIP switches are located on the side of the device, and each switch has two settings, 0 & 1 (UP=0, DOWN=1). The default mode is “00000” which is all up, in this mode the device copies the EDID from the sink (display) plugged into OUTPUT 1.
  • Page 11 AC-DA12-AUHD EDID Setting Continued: 1. The AC-DA12-AUHD is set this way by default for maximum “Plug & Play” Compatibility. If you change sink (Display) plugged into OUTPUT 1, please follow the steps below if you wish to use the new sink's EDID. Start with power off Set DIP to ‘00000’...
  • Page 12 AC-DA12-AUHD To use Scaler: Press the SCALER Button to toggle on/off Red LED On, then the scaler is on. Scaler On - Downscales 4k to 1080p on output #2 Scaler light Off - No Scaling CTRL/ISP Micro USB Port for firmware and control. Command list on Page 13.
